Research and Development Specialist in Antenna

il y a 3 semaines


Luxembourg University of Luxembourg Temps plein

**About the SnT...** SnT** is a leading **international research and innovation centre** in secure, reliable and trustworthy ICT systems and services. We play an instrumental role in Luxembourg by fueling innovation through research partnerships with industry, boosting R&D investments leading to economic growth, and attracting highly qualified talent.

We’re looking for people driven by excellence, excited about innovation, and looking to make a difference. If this sounds like you, you’ve come to the right place
**Your Role...**

In summary, the position holder will be required to perform the following tasks:

- Measurement of antenna parameters.
- Disseminating results through scientific publications and conferences.
- Preparing new research proposals to attract industrial, national, and European projects.
- Providing assistance for Ph.D. students.

**Your Profile...**
- Master (or equivalent) in Telecommunication Engineering or Electrical Engineering focused on **antenna design and their implementation using additive manufacturing techniques**. The topic of antennas and metasurface design for satellite systems is desired but not mandatory.
- Sound publication track record in relevant international conferences and top journals in the following research areas.
- Experience with machine learning and artificial intelligence is highly desirable.
- **Strong design skills in CST Microwave Studio**, Advance Design System (ADS), and High-Frequency Simulations Software (HFSS) design tools are mandatory.
- Experience in MEEP programming is desirable but not mandatory.
- **Strong programming skills in MATLAB**. Python, JULIA, and C++ are desirable but not mandatory.
- Experience in** additive manufacturing and metallization techniques is required**.
- Experience in **antenna measurements is required.**:

- Experience working with industrial or publicly funded research projects is highly desirable.
- Highly committed, **excellent team worker**, and strong critical thinking skills.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ills in English.

**About the University of Luxembourg...** University of Luxembourg** is an **international research** university with a distinctly **multilingual** and **interdisciplinary** character. The University was founded in 2003 and counts more than 6,700 students and more than 2,000 employees from around the world. The University’s faculties and interdisciplinary centres focus on research in the areas of Computer Science and ICT Security, Materials Science, European and International Law, Finance and Financial Innovation, Education, Contemporary and Digital History. In addition, the University focuses on cross-disciplinary research in the areas of Data Modelling and Simulation as well as Health and System Biomedicine. Times Higher Education ranks the University of Luxembourg #3 worldwide for its “international outlook,” #20 in the Young University Ranking 2021 and among the top 250 universities worldwide.
